Understanding the flow through porous media when it is part of geotechnical-hydraulic structures has been a scenario calculated from the most unfavorable situation. The passage of water through the porous skeleton of the soil is considered in a saturated condition. Few studies to date consider partially saturated trajectories regarding the influence on the stability of a dam, reservoir, embankment, among others. Estimating the speed with which the fluid under analysis flows through a partially saturated media is challenging to perform by conventional methods. By contrast, nowadays, it is easy to obtain for saturated soil. This study aimed to measure hydraulic conductivity (coefficient of permeability) in granular soils using easily accessible laboratory techniques. The permeability in unsaturated conditions will be measured, varying the suction in the sample, which is an essential requirement when there is a situation of partial saturation. The results provided data on the permeability values that allow to obtain a very evident difference between both proposed conditions.
El entendimiento del flujo a través de medios porosos cuando hace parte de estructuras geotécnico-hidráulicas, a través del tiempo ha sido un escenario calculado desde la situación más desfavorable. Es decir, el paso del agua por el tejido poroso del suelo siempre se considera en una condición saturada. Pocos estudios a la fecha, consideran trayectorias parcialmente saturadas, en cuanto a la influencia sobre la estabilidad de una presa, reservorio, terraplén, entre otros. La estimación de la velocidad con la que el fluido bajo análisis traspasa un medio parcialmente saturado, es difícil de realizar mediante métodos convencionales. Antagónicamente, hoy día es sencilla de obtener para un suelo saturado. El objetivo de este estudio consistió en intentar medir la conductividad hidráulica (coeficiente de permeabilidad), en suelos granulares usando técnicas de laboratorio de fácil acceso. La permeabilidad en condición no saturada fue medida, variando la succión en la muestra, lo cual es requisito esencial cuando existe una situación de saturación parcial. Los resultados arrojan datos sobre los valores de permeabilidad que permiten trazar una diferencia muy evidente entre ambas condiciones propuestas.
